Function:
May associate with CD21. May regulate the release of Ca(2+) from intracellular stores.
Subcellular Location:
Cytoplasm (By similarity). Melanosome. Note=Identified by mass spectrometry in melanosome fractions from stage I to stage IV.
Induction:
By EBV.
Domain:
A pair of annexin repeats may form one binding site for calcium and phospholipid.
Ptm:
Phosphorylated in response to growth factor stimulation.
Miscellaneous:
Seems to bind one calcium ion with high affinity.
Similarity:
Belongs to the annexin family.

Contains 8 annexin repeats. Summary: Annexin VI belongs to a family of calcium-dependent membrane and phospholipid binding proteins. Although their functions are still not clearly defined several members of the annexin family have been implicated in membrane-related events along exocytotic and endocytotic pathways. The annexin VI gene is approximately 60 kbp long and contains 26 exons. It encodes a protein of about 68 kDa that consists of eight 68-amino acid repeats separated by linking sequences of variable lengths. It is highly similar to human annexins I and II sequences each of which contain four such repeats. Exon 21 of annexin VI is alternatively spliced giving rise to two isoforms that differ by a 6-amino acid insertion at the start of the seventh repeat. Annexin VI has been implicated in mediating the endosome aggregation and vesicle fusion in secreting epithelia during exocytosis. Cuschieri. J. . et al. . (2005) Surgery 138 (2). 158-164.
